AT&T is reportedly preparing for the launch of the 'iPhone 5' in late September, reports BGR.
According to a trusted AT&T source, the carrier is currently planning to launch Apple's (AAPL) next-generation iPhone during the third or fourth week of September, with an all-hands-on-deck policy in place for employees that will extend through to the middle of October. A second AT&T source confirms that a large training event for regional employees has been rescheduled from the first week of October due to a conflict with a "huge announcement."
Apple is widely expected to unveil the next generation iPhone at a September 12th event.
